Chimp Rescue (15)
There are less than 300,000 chimpanzees left in the wild, but people from many organizations work tirelessly every day to protect and care for these amazing apes. Readers explore what life is like for both chimps and workers in sanctuaries created to provide a safe environment for chimps to live. As they learn what goes on in these sanctuaries, they also learn fascinating facts about chimps. Colorful photographs and helpful fact boxes engage readers as they learn. Readers discover the importance of conservation and are introduced to famous figures in the growing movement to protect chimps, including Jane Goodall.
